Mrs. Linda Burriss Roberts, widow of Williams Roberts, was born in Anderson, South Carolina to the late Jim Henry and Ojecter Burriss.
Linda graduated from Westside High School, received her Bachelor of Science Degree from Benedict College and her master's Degree from South Carolina State University. She taught English at Westside High School for 34 Years. She also wrote the school's Alma Mater. She was also a charter member of Alpha Kappa Alpha Sorority, Inc.
Linda is survived by her sons Terence Victor (Natalie), William Todd, Albert McKinley and Kory Glennis (Jackie); seven grandchildren, Tera Victoria, Terence Jr. (Kelly), Brandon McKinley, Bryce Albert, Kory Jr., Kelsey Yvette and Jala Denise Roberts; and a great-grandson, Blair Robert Clark. She is survived sisters, Carolyn Conner (Curtis), Phyllis Thompson (David) and Deborah Logan (Walter), as well as several nieces, nephews, and close friends.
Linda was preceded in death by her sisters, Christine Rainey and Edith Hunter and brother Jimmy Ray Burriss.
Linda was loved and will be missed by all who knew her.
